Transaction 015115be992097ef26063153a75acab1ff1ada590409db6344ab3556fab354f0
1 Input
1 Output
-
015115be992097ef26063153a75acab1ff1ada590409db6344ab3556fab354f0:0
- value
- 31341369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04867e3b8bb10f182e0d80ea057df4b28983da5e OP_EQUAL
- address
- 326wk4A14gsJ5mZKS7ZU4VFPr23DCQ21iQ